What exactly is a Registered Agent?

An registered agent represents a person or business organization appointed to receive and process official documents on behalf of the corporation or LLC. This entails important paperwork including notices of service process, tax-related paperwork, and filings for annual reports. The registered agent serves as the designated point of contact between the company and state authorities, ensuring that the entity is compliant with local laws.

The role of a registered agent is vital for maintaining good standing with the state. By having a reliable registered agent, companies can avoid missed communications that could result in penalties or legal issues. Registered agents are often required to have an office in the state where the company is registered, acting as a corporate address where legal documents can be delivered.

In addition to managing legal paperwork, many registered agents also include additional services such as reminders for compliance, business mail handling, and assistance during state filings. Such services can be invaluable for entrepreneurs who want to focus on their main activities while ensuring that their legal and compliance obligations are met in a timely manner.

Registered Agent Expectations and Fees

To appoint a designated agent for your company, there are specific requirements that differ by state. Typically, a registered agent must be a inhabitant of the state in which the business is formed or recognized, or an authorized organization that provides registered agent services. This representative should maintain a physical address in the state, as P.O. boxes are not permitted. Additionally, the registered agent should be accessible during normal operating hours to collect important legal documents and official communications on behalf of the business.

When evaluating registered agent services, it is important to be aware of the associated costs. The price for contracting a registered agent can range widely based on the supplier and specific services provided. On average, businesses can anticipate to pay between $50 to $300 per year for registered agent services. Elements influencing the cost include the quality of service provided, whether additional regulatory and management services are included, and the standing of the registered agent company. Affordable options do exist, and many businesses can find trustworthy registered agent solutions that suit their budget.

In addition to the annual fees, businesses should also be cognizant of potential hidden costs when contracting a registered agent. These might consist of fees for document handling, compliance reminders, or additional services such as mail forwarding or annual report filings. Comprehending the complete fee structure, including registered agent renewal charges and any potential charges for additional services, is crucial to avoid surprises down the line. Taking the time to compare registered agent services and their costs can guarantee that you choose the best service that meets both your needs and your budget.
